RMNE to salute veterans Nov. 11

- RAILROAD MUSEUM OF NEW ENGLAND

THOMASTON — All veterans and their families are invited to attend the fourth annual “Salute to Veterans” on Sunday, Nov.11 from 8 to 10 a.m. at the Thomaston Railroad Station, at 242 East Main Street in Thomaston.

The Railroad Museum of New England is partnering with the Thomaston’s American Legion Post 22 and the Thomaston Savings Bank. In addition to a ceremony of appreciati­on, coffee and breakfast will be served.

Jason Meehan, Post 22 Commander of Thomaston’s American Legion, and other Post officials will lead the program to commemorat­e veterans of all wars. Meehan planned the event with Steve Casey, President of the RMNE, and Kim Curry, Thomaston Savings Bank Branch Manager.

“We are extremely pleased with the community support we get every year for this worthwhile event,” Casey stated. “We try to thank veterans every day for their sacrifices, so it’s great to be part of a team to do something special to recognize them. This year’s Veterans Day is especially important because it is the 100th anniversar­y of the signing the armistice of that ended World War I.”

The RMNE, at the historic Thomaston Train Station, is a not-for-profit, all volunteer, educationa­l and historical organizati­on that dates to January 1968. The mission of the RMNE is to tell the story of the region’s rich railroad heritage through educationa­l exhibits and the operation of the Naugatuck Railroad.
